Output d21e05e431496ae64f55f9d532c44f81a63907fcb1ee0ae27db79b08f408a4b4:1

value
1578976
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5fabc224b5239c82f7c40c6ba095f144b23d436 OP_EQUALVERIFY OP_CHECKSIG
address
1PRcvN9XQoXMXv1HP85mmPo1mrovee7ibq
transaction
d21e05e431496ae64f55f9d532c44f81a63907fcb1ee0ae27db79b08f408a4b4
spent
true